Consider running the Perceptron algorithm in the online model on some sequence of examples S Let S be the same set of examples as S but presented in a different order. Does the Perceptron algorithm necessarily make the same number of mistakes on S as it does on S If so why? If not, show such an S and Sconsisting of the same set of examples in a different order where the Perceptron algorithm makes a different number of mistakes on S than it does on S
